A right triangle has a hypotenuse C=12cm and a an angle A= 30°. find the length of side a, witch is opposite angle A

Mathematics
1 answer:
Alisiya [41]3 years ago
7 0
Use the sin identity to find that side.  Sin(30) = a/12...12 sin(30) = a, and a = 6
